Description Weekend shift: Working hours are 6:00AM-6:30PM Friday through Sunday. 11% pay differential is added onto pay for 3rd shift. Position Purpose: Primary function is in operating forming machinery, by ensuring a running machine, basic maintenance and mechanical changes as needed. Operators ensure that a sound product will move onto the next department based on Process Instructions. The Operator range falls into levels 1 through 3, indicating an increase in responsibilities and technical knowledge. Essential Duties and Responsibilities: Runs product through forming machinery which may include cutting, knifing, band sawing, deburring, sanding, cleaning, and/or packaging each product as needed. Follow Process Instructions and ensure ATI process and quality standards are met. Loads and unloads mold forming fixtures and parts with assistance from Material Handler and forklift. Uses router and/or band saw to trim parts. Ensure a clean workstation using broom and dustpan and/or compressed air each day. Performs general maintenance and mechanical changes of equipment with assistance under direct supervision. Accurately read, record and use calipers, height gauges, Vernier calipers, and micrometers. Record necessary information for output monitoring, quality verification, and production reporting. Accurately enters production job and punches into and out of database system. Communicates “out of tolerance” conditions and documentation discrepancies to supervisor in a timely manner. Follow and practice safety procedures. Other duties and responsibilities to be assigned as needed. Requirements Experience, Qualifications, and Skillset Necessary: Read, write, and be conversant in the English language required. Ability to perform basic computerized time clock data entry required. Team oriented and strong level of independence required. Detailed oriented with strong attention for accuracy required. Physical Requirements and Work Environment: Usual warehouse and production environment involves frequent standing, walking, sitting, climbing, stooping, kneeling, crouching, and balancing. Postures include climbing in and out of fork trunk, walking/standing, forceful gripping, vision, , squatting, and forward reaching. Frequently lifts, carries or balances up to 50 pounds, occasionally up to 75 pounds. Frequently climbs in and out of 48.5-inch-deep “pits” to repair/adjust machine. Frequent use of eye, hand, and finger coordination. Verbal and auditory capacity, with or without assistance, enabling communication in person as well as through automated devices such as the telephone. Visual capacity could include one or more of the following: depth perception, color vision, and peripheral vision enabling operation of machinery.
